Waste reduction is a critical sustainability metric for the food industry, and extending freshness is the most direct way to combat it. The search for robust Shelf Life Extension Solutions has historically pitted longevity against clean labels. However, advanced mold inhibitor technology is resolving this conflict. By leveraging biochemistry rather than synthetic chemistry, manufacturers can now dramatically prolong the "best by" date while offering a product that appears completely minimally processed to the end user.

The mechanisms behind these solutions are sophisticated. It is not simply about creating a hostile pH; it is about molecular interference. Specific plant peptides and organic acids can interrupt the mold’s quorum sensing—the biological communication mechanism that spores use to coordinate growth. By silencing this signaling, a product remains unspoiled for weeks longer because the mold never receives the biological signal to proliferate, even if a few spores are present. These Shelf Life Extension Solutions are particularly crucial for global distribution chains where products face temperature fluctuations and long transit times. As per Market Research Future, the ability to maintain structural integrity and taste over an extended period is the primary technical challenge being addressed by these novel inhibitors.

The snack bar and alternative protein sectors are key beneficiaries. These matrices are often formulated to be moist and nutrient-dense, creating a perfect breeding ground for visible mold. Syrups infused with natural antimicrobials from monk fruit or chicory root are now replacing sugar syrups that previously relied on high sugar concentration alone to prevent spoilage. This allows for the sugar reduction consumers demand without sacrificing the stability required by retailers. The beauty of these solutions lies in their labeling. An antimicrobial solution derived from chickpea flour or rice hulls functions as a dry ingredient, integrating seamlessly into the bulk mix without the need for a separate "preservative" line on the label.

Adoption requires a holistic view of the product. These inhibitors work best when paired with active packaging that manages headspace moisture. The combination of a clean label formula with a bio-based packaging substrate creates a total system that rivals the protection of any artificial additive. As per Market Research Future, the convergence of ingredient innovation and packaging technology is accelerating the availability of truly clean products with industry-leading shelf lives, debunking the myth that natural foods must spoil quickly.

FAQ's

  1. Can these solutions work in frozen products?
    While primarily designed for ambient and chilled storage, certain inhibitors protect the product during the thawing process, preventing a rapid bloom of mold spores once the temperature rises.
  2. Are shelf life extension solutions cost-prohibitive compared to synthetics?
    Historically, yes, but through advancements in fermentation scale-up and waste-stream valorization, the price gap is closing rapidly, making them accessible for mass-market brands.
